Microsoft Windows Server 2016

Материал из Национальной библиотеки им. Н. Э. Баумана
Последнее изменение этой страницы: 19:39, 29 января 2017.
Microsoft Windows Server 2016
Версия операционной системы Microsoft Windows NT
Windows-server-2016.png
Разработчик Microsoft Corporation
Линейка ОС Microsoft Windows
Исходный код Закрытый код and shared source
Дата выхода на
производство
26 September 2016 года; 3 years ago (2016-09-26)[1]
Общая
доступность
12 October 2016 года; 3 years ago (2016-10-12)[2]
Последний релиз 1607 (10.0.14393)
Метод обновления Microsoft Windows Update, Microsoft Windows Server Update Services, SCCM
Платформы x86-64
Ядро (тип) Гибридное ядро (Windows NT)
По умолчанию
пользовательский
интерфейс
Microsoft Windows Shell (Graphical)
Microsoft PowerShell (Command line)
Лицензия Trialware, VLK, Microsoft Software Assurance, Microsoft Developer Network, Microsoft Imagine
Предшественник Microsoft Windows Server 2012 R2 (2013)
Официальный веб-сайт windows.com
Статус поддержки
  • Start date: October 15, 2016[3]
  • Mainstream support: Until January 11, 2022
  • Extended support: Until January 11, 2027
Интерфейс рабочего стола

Windows Server 2016 (кодовое имя Windows Server vNext) — серверная операционная система от Microsoft, которая обеспечивает новый уровень безопасности и инноваций для ваших приложений и инфраструктуры вашей компании. Функции Windows Server 2016 на базе облачных технологий позволяют увеличить конкурентоспособность центра обработки данных. Усовершенствования в области вычислений, сетевой инфраструктуры, систем хранения и безопасности обеспечивают дополнительную гибкость для соответствия изменяющимся бизнес-требованиям. Более высокая скорость подключения и адаптивность достигаются благодаря таким функциям современных платформ для приложений как Windows Server Containers.[4]

Новые возможности

  • Механизм обновления ОС хостов кластера без его остановки (Cluster Operating System Rolling Upgrade) — это происходит через создание смешанного кластера Windows Server 2012 R2 и Windows Server vNext.
  • Синхронная репликация хранилищ на уровне блоков с поддержкой географически распределенных кластеров.
  • Виртуальный сетевой контроллер (software-defined networking stack) для одновременного управления физическими и виртуальными сетями.
  • Новый формат файлов конфигурации виртуальных машин (.VMCX и .VMRS), с более высокой степенью защиты от сбоев на уровне хранилища. Также можно будет обновлять версии конфигурационных файлов.
  • Можно будет создавать снапшоты прямо из гостевой ОС.
  • Полноценный Storage Quality of Service (QoS) — возможность динамического отслеживания производительности хранилищ и горячая миграция виртуальных машин при превышении этими хранилищами пороговых значений (IOPS).
  • Изменения в самом Hyper-V: использование альтернативных аккаунтов (хранение нескольких учётных данных одного человека, возможность использования по времени), возможность управления предыдущими версиями Hyper-V в корпоративной инфраструктуре, обновление и улучшение протокола удалённого управления, возможность безопасной загрузки гостевых операционных систем Linux
  • Возможность обновления Integration Services через Windows Update.
  • «Горячее» добавление сетевых карт и оперативной памяти.
  • Поддержка OpenGL и OpenCL для Remote Desktop.
  • Возможности публикации приложений.
  • Совместимость с режимом Connected Standby.

[5]

Windows Server 2016 (Hyper-V)

  • Элемент маркированного списка
  • Клиент Hyper-V поддерживает Windows 10;
  • Совместимость с Connected Standby;
  • Назначение дискретного устройства;
  • Мониторинг чрезмерной активности виртуальных машин с целью экономии ресурсов (RCT);
  • Использование альтернативных учетных данных при подключении к другой системе Windows Server 2016;
  • Обновленный протокол управления и другие улучшения.

Улучшения Hyper-V менеджер

  • Alternate credentials support - теперь можно использовать другие креды в Hyper-V Manager, когла вы соединяетесь с другим хостом Windows Server 2016 or Windows 10. Также их можно сохранять.
  • Управление старыми версиями - в Hyper-V Manager для Windows Server 2016 и Windows 10 вы можете управлять платформой Hyper-V в ОС Windows Server 2012, Windows 8, Windows Server 2012 R2 и Windows 8.1.
  • Обновленный протокол управления - теперь вся коммуникация с удаленными хостами идет по протоколу WS-MAN, который предоставляет функции аутентификации CredSSP, Kerberos или NTLM.[6]

Linux Secure Boot (безопасная загрузка Linux)

У Hyper-V Windows Server 2016 появилась возможность включения опции Secure Boot, т.е. безопасная загрузка, для гостевых операционных систем Linux (Ubuntu 14.04 и более поздние версии, Red Hat Enterprise Linux 7.0 и выше, и CentOS 7.0 и выше). Данная опция защищает виртуальную машину от атак rootkit и других вредоносных программ, активируемых при загрузке системы. Ранее данная опция была доступна только для Windows 8/8.1 и Windows Server 2012.[7]Для Windows Powershell выполните следующую команду:

Set-VMFirmware vmname -SecureBootTemplate MicrosoftUEFICertificateAuthority

Контейнеры Windows Server и Hyper-V

Одно из основных нововведений Windows Server 2016 является применение технологии контейнеров. Это технология позволяет изолировать приложения от операционной системы тем самым, обеспечивая надежность, а также улучшая их развертывание. В Windows Server 2016 существует два типа контейнеров: Windows Server Containers и Hyper-V Containers. Контейнеры Windows Server обеспечивают изоляцию через пространство имен и изоляцию процессов. Контейнеры Hyper-V отличаются более надежной изоляцией благодаря их запуску в виртуальной машине. [8]

Storage Replica

В Windows Server 2016 появилась новая технология Storage Replica. Она подразумевает репликацию томов в Windows на уровне блоков с использованием протокола SMB. Технология Storage Replica позволяет использовать синхронную репликацию томов между серверами для аварийного восстановления без какой-либо возможности потери данных. [8]

Защита ресурсов размещения

Эта функция помогает предотвратить виртуальной машины с помощью более чем часть системных ресурсов, поиск чрезмерного уровнем активности. Это может помочь предотвратить снижения производительности узла или других виртуальных машин высокой активности виртуальной машины. Обнаружив мониторинга виртуальной машины с высокой активности, виртуальная машина получает меньше ресурсов.[7] Это наблюдения и принудительного применения отключено по умолчанию. Включить или отключить с помощью Windows PowerShell. Чтобы включить его, выполните следующую команду:

Set-VMProcessor -EnableHostResourceProtection $true

Вложенные виртуализации

Эта функция позволяет использовать виртуальную машину в качестве узла Hyper-V и создании виртуальных машин в рамках этого виртуализированных узла. Это может быть особенно полезно для средах разработки и тестирования. Чтобы использовать вложенные виртуализации, вам понадобятся:

  • По крайней мере 4 ГБ ОЗУ, доступный для виртуализированных узла Hyper-V
  • Для выполнения по крайней мере 4 технических предварительной версии Windows Server 2016 или Windows 10 построений 10565 на физическом узле Hyper-V и виртуальных узлов. Выполнение этого построения в физических и виртуальных средах обычно улучшает производительность.
  • Процессор Intel VT-x (вложенные виртуализации доступен только для процессоров Intel® в настоящее время).[7]

Выпуски Windows Server 2016

Для Windows Server2016 доступны выпуски Standard, Datacenter и Essentials. Windows Server2016 Datacenter включает неограниченные права на виртуализацию, а также новые возможности для создания программно-определяемого центра обработки данных. Windows Server2016 Standard предлагает возможности корпоративного класса с ограниченными правами на виртуализацию. Windows Server Essentials— оптимальный вариант для первого сервера, подключенного к облаку. [9]

Таблица.png

Windows server Datacenter

В частности Windows Server 2016 Datacenter поддерживает следующие технологии:

  • Storage Spaces Direct — расширение технологии Storage Spaces для создания HA хранилищ для кластеров
  • Storage Replica – технология блочной синхронной мультисайтовой репликации между кластерами
  • Shielded Virtual Machines — технологию создания защищенных виртуальных машин, чей контент защищен от администратора хост-системы Hyper-V
  • Host Guardian Service – роль сервера для поддержки защищенных виртуальные машины (Shielded Virtual Machines) и данные на них от несанкционированного доступа
  • Network Fabric
  • Microsoft Azure Stack — SDN стек на основе Azure[10]

Аппаратные требования

Для того чтобы можно было пользоваться серверной операционной системой Windows Server 2016, Вам минимум потребуется:

  • Процессор с тактовой частотой 1,4 ГГц совместимый с набором команд x64 (64-разрядный процессор);
  • Оперативной памяти необходимо: 512 МБ для установки на физический сервер, 800 МБ, если Вы будите осуществлять установку на виртуальную машину, 2 ГБ для установки с графическим интерфейсом;
  • Для базовой установки требуется 32 гигабайта свободного места на жестком диске (если установку производить на сервер с оперативной памятью более чем 16 ГБ, то потребуется дополнительное пространство на диске для файлов подкачки);
  • Сетевой адаптер с гигабитной пропускной способностью, совместимый со спецификацией PCI Express архитектурой и поддержкой Execution Environment (PXE).[8]

Лицензирование

Схема лицензирования в Server 2016 тоже подверглась изменениям и теперь лицензирование производится не по сокетам, а по ядрам процессора. Соответственно стоимость лицензии рассчитывается не по числу физических процессоров (как в Server 2012), а по числу процессорных ядер. Подобная схема лицензирования используется в MS SQL Server. Одна лицензия Windows Server 2016 будет стоить в восемь раз дешевле, чем лицензия Windows Server 2012. Однако одна новая лицензия будет покрывать только 2 физических ядра.

Порядок лицензирования ядер следующий:
Лицензирование.png
  • Лицензируются все физические ядра сервера. Ядра с Hyper-threading считаются одним ядром;
  • Если процессор отключен на уровне системы, его ядра лицензировать не нужно;
  • Минимальное количество приобретаемых лицензий на ядра одного процессора — 8 шт;
  • Минимальное количество лицензий на ядра одного сервера — 16 шт.

К примеру, для лицензирования однопроцессорного 16-ядерного сервера потребуется комплект из восьми 2-ядерных лицензий, для одного физического сервера с двумя 4-ядерными процессорами также придется приобрести 8 комплектов 2-ядерных лицензий. [10]

Установка Microsoft Windows Server

Для того, чтобы установить windows server 2016 на компьютер, нам нужно использовать загрузочный носитель. Для его создания нам потребуется образ сервера:

и программа, преобразующая образ сервера в загрузчик с флешки:

В настройках BIOS выбираем UEFI-boot. Выбираем в настройках образ флешки. Далее устанавливаем windows server на физический компьютер. Voila!

Добавление роли Hyper-V

Настройка состоит из 2-х этапов, которые нужно выполнить последовательно.

  • Сначала заходим в "Настройки" виртуальной машины Microsoft Windows Server 2016, далее переходим в вкладку "Система", там нас интересует "Ускорение". Интерфейс паравиртуализации должен быть настроен на "Hyper-V", а аппаратная виртуализация должна поддерживать "VT-x/AMD-V".
  • Войдя в среду Microsoft Windows Server 2016, нам потребуется открыть Windows PowerShell ISE. После открытия последовательно вводим ряд инструкций, представленных в листинге ниже. Каждая инструкция должна быть введена максимально точно, иначе система её не распознает.
  1. Сначала пишем:
    Enable-WindowsOptionalFeature –Online -FeatureName Microsoft-Hyper-V –All -NoRestart
  2. Далее:
    Install-WindowsFeature RSAT-Hyper-V-Tools -IncludeAllSubFeature
  3. Далее:
    Install-WindowsFeature RSAT-Clustering -IncludeAllSubFeature
  4. Далее:
    Install-WindowsFeature Multipath-IO
  5. И, наконец, даем системе команду перезапуститься:
    Restart-Computer

Создание виртуальной машины через Hyper-V на Windows Server 2016

Настройка сетей

Сначала ищем в "Действиях" опцию "Диспетчер виртуальных коммутаторов". Далее смотрим на скрин и настраиваем в соответствие с ним.

Настройка сетей

Создание виртуального жесткого диска

Для создания жесткого диска выполняем последовательно несколько шагов, представленных на скринах:

Шаг №1
Создание виртуального ЖД1.png
Шаг №2
Создание виртуального ЖД2.png
Шаг №3
Создание виртуального ЖД3.png
Шаг №4
Создание виртуального ЖД4.png
Шаг №5
Создание виртуального ЖД5.png

Выполнение инструкций по созданию виртуальной машины в Hyper-V

В интерфейсе диспетчера Hyper-V нетрудно найти в действиях опцию "Создать" - > "Новая виртуальная машина". Далее рекомендую придерживатьcя следующих настроек:

1) Имя задаем любое, так ваша ВМ будет называться в последующем

Поэтапное создание ВМ.png

2) Поколение выбираем в зависимости от устанавливаемой операционной системы

Поэтапное создание ВМ2.png

3) Выбираем нужное количество оперативной памяти

Поэтапное создание ВМ3.png

4) В настройках сети выбираем такое подключение, которое мы создали ранее (виртуальный коммутатор)

Поэтапное создание ВМ4.png

5) В настройках подключения виртуального ЖД выбираем заранее созданный нами виртуальный (см. выше в описании)

Поэтапное создание ВМ5.png

6) Подтверждаем выбранные настройки

Поэтапное создание ВМ6.png

7) В меню виртуальных машин нажимаем "подключить" ВМ, потом вставляем образ диска: Медиа -> DVD - дисковод -> Вставка диска

Поэтапное создание ВМ7.png

8) Выбираем свободный диск, куда можно записать образ ОС.

Поэтапное создание ВМ8.png

9) Когда произойдет reboot - перезагрузка, вынимаем диск из дисковода в Медиа -> DVD - дисковод -> Изъять диск из привода

В конечном итоге мы получаем результат

Поэтапное создание ВМ9.png

Вот так выглядят рекомендуемые настройки ВМ

Параметры ВМ.png

Источники

  1. Chapple, Erin (September 26, 2016). "Announcing the launch of Windows Server 2016". Hybrid Cloud. Microsoft. 
  2. Foley, Mary Jo (12 October 2016). "Microsoft's Windows Server 2016 hits general availability". ZDNet (CBS Interactive). 
  3. "Microsoft Product Lifecycle". Microsoft Support. Microsoft. Retrieved December 7, 2016. 
  4. Windows Server 2016 [Электронный ресурс]: Windows Server 2016 / Дата обращения: 15.11.2016. — Режим доступа:http://cwer.ws/node/416975/
  5. Википедия [Электронный ресурс]: Материал из Википедии — свободной энциклопедии: — Режим доступа:https://ru.wikipedia.org/wiki/Windows_Server_2016
  6. Windows Server 2016 [Электронный ресурс]: Вышел Windows Server 2016 - новые возможности платформы виртуализации. / Дата обращения: 23.11.2016. — Режим доступа:http://www.vmgu.ru/news/microsoft-windows-server-2016-hyper-v
  7. 7,0 7,1 7,2 Windows Server 2016 [Электронный ресурс]:Новые возможности Hyper-V в Windows Server 2016 / Дата обращения: 21.11.2016. — Режим доступа:https://technet.microsoft.com/windows-server-docs/compute/hyper-v/what-s-new-in-hyper-v-on-windows#BKMK_hot
  8. 8,0 8,1 8,2 Windows Server 2016 [Электронный ресурс]:Установка Windows Server 2016 и обзор новых возможностей. / Дата обращения: 21.11.2016. — Режим доступа:http://info-comp.ru/sisadminst/543-install-and-review-of-windows-server-2016.html
  9. Windows Server 2016 [Электронный ресурс]: Выпуски Windows Server2016 / Дата обращения: 01.11.2016. — Режим доступа:https://technet.microsoft.com/ru-ru/windows-server-docs/get-started/windows-server-2016
  10. 10,0 10,1 Windows Server 2016 [Электронный ресурс]:Редакции и особенности лицензирования Windows Server 2016. / Дата обращения: 13.11.2016. — Режим доступа:http://windowsnotes.ru/windows-server-2016/redakcii-i-osobennosti-licenzirovaniya-windows-server-2016/